I was wandering if the Flexx bars are any benifitial to mx riders. Ive searched and i know they are a big help for gncc and harescrambles but do they really help for mx?? Alot of A riders and 2 pros told me that they are not very benifitial for mx??

400grl
01-18-2006, 02:35 PM
THAT DEPENDS......if you are in great condition, and you have plenty of hand/arm strength and you race on tracks that don't get that rough, then maybe not......

But for me, I need the help the Flexxbars give me in regards to keeping fatique at bay for much longer than I normaly get tired. My hands/arms aren't very strong, and I get tired out pretty quick on a rough track or at a very fast pace......the edge the Flexxbars gives me helps me tremendously even on shorter MX races. For racing WORCS, I can't wait to try them out....they help cushion those really sharp edged jarring holes you hit sometimes as well as help in rough braking bumps.......it's all about keeping the strength in your hands/arms just a little longer........
